Slicker — Slick er, n. That which makes smooth or sleek. Specifically: (a) A kind of burnisher for leather. (b) (Founding) A curved tool for smoothing the surfaces of a mold after the withdrawal of the pattern. [1913 Webster] … The Collaborative International Dictionary of English
Slicker — Slick er, n. A waterproof coat. [Western U.S.] [1913 Webster] … The Collaborative International Dictionary of English
slicker — (n.) waterproof raincoat, 1884, from SLICK (Cf. slick) (v.); sense of clever and crafty person is from 1900 … Etymology dictionary
slicker — [slik′ər] n. [ SLICK, adj. + ER ] ☆ 1. a loose, waterproof coat made of oil treated cloth ☆ 2. Informal a tricky, cleverly deceptive person … English World dictionary
